Abstract
The function and significance of mission-critical software-intensive systems have got substantial recognition. Software architecture has become a new field since system software is all the time more intricate. Agile software development counters the advancement in requirement, besides to attend to the fixed plan. In this paper, the effort has been made to find parameters for software architecture evaluation and then evaluate software architecture under agile environment based on the determined parameters.
